How do you get 100s of FPS in Minecraft?

Go to “video settings” and do the following:

  1. Set maximum fps to Unlimited.
  2. Turn off clouds and smooth lighting.
  3. Set particles to minimal.
  4. Turn off V-Sync.
  5. Disable biome smoothing.
  6. Turn “Graphics” to “fast.”
  7. Turn down the FOV (field of view).

Why is Minecraft running at 20fps?

Sometimes when playing Minecraft: Java Edition, you may experience a low FPS (frames per second) or frame rate. This may be caused due to applications running in the background or simply not having enough processing power to run the game smoothly at your current settings.

Is 100 FPS good for Minecraft?

Anything at or above 30 fps will be comfortably playable for most players, and this is probably a good goal to set for yourself if you’re trying to optimize your game. Anything above 60 FPS will be silky-smooth and will give you the best game experience.

What does Max FPS mean?

Frames Per Second. What the ‘Max FPS’ setting does is push your minecraft to the limits with fps. It will give you as much fps as possible but will slow down other programs. The ‘Balanced’ setting lowers your fps to keep other programs running fast. On ‘Balanced’ I only get around 30-40 fps, while on ‘Max FPS’ I get 100-300.

Why is my fps so low in Minecraft?

Difficult calculations (like blowing up large amounts of TNT or spawning in a large number of mobs) can temporarily decrease the FPS to a complete stop. Press F3 to bring up the debug screen. The frame rate will be shown under the Minecraft version at the top left.
